“…Unequal spacing is usually caused by tailgating, thereby, allowing the driver to misjudge its decisions based on the minimum required safe distance between two vehicles. Another factor of phantom traffic jams is the frequent lane changing because leading vehicles do not give way to faster trailing cars [3]. To mitigate the phantom traffic jam phenomenon, car manufacturers developed autonomous vehicles as well as technologies like adaptive cruise control (ACC) [4], lane keep assist [5] and automatic braking [6] which are designed to intervene with the driver's inputs when necessary.…”
